Nice!! http://home.comcast.net/~Komeuppance/HdrRain2.jpg This is a 225/50 8" -10 with camber plates set maxed out for as little camber as possible. If you compare the specs with 255/40 10" +0, the top of your tire will be the same as mine in the pic. -10 offset might have been better with what you were planning for Oni-camber. But +0 could be better because you can always add a spacer to dial it in perfect to just the way you want. -Robert -

87 quest engine not fully rotating
Komeuppance replied to bizniz's topic in Newbie Question and Answers
Welcome to the site!! Don't spin the engine backwards, the timing will jump. You should reset the timing now that its been reverse rotated, all you need to do is pull the valve cover. Download the factory service manual if you haven't already. The g54b is an interference engine, just barely, you'd have to have the timing seriously off before finding that out though. -Robert -

NikoFab Wilwood Big Brake Kit: Cancelled Not Enough Interest
Komeuppance replied to NikoFab's topic in Group Purchase Info
The 3kgt calipers are the same as z32 calipers, which already have a bracket designed for them. The cad dimensions are available at the Australian site. This will probably be the quickest option. As far as MC's, it hasn't been fully sorted out yet, but Matt was close. In Australia they use a Nissan Patrol MC, we could use it too but the fittings attach on the wrong side for LHD cars. New hardlines would not be too much work to make, but that is beyond the scope of a group buy kit I believe. Perhaps SS braided adapter lines... but that would look bulky and cumbersome. Regardless, I'm glad to see someone's taken an interest in a brake upgrade kit... going fast involves more than just a straight line lol. -Robert -

The front sump pick up tube provides more volume because of a larger I.D. But, 99% of builds won't notice the difference, it just depends on what pick up tube you have available. -Robert

Ohm test your coolant temp sensor. It should be less than 300ohms when the engine is fully warmed up (176F). -Robert

83 Starions and all year trucks used mid sump pickup tubes. 84-89 Starions used a front sump pick up tube. You have a mid sump style. -Robert
